Berkeley, CA’s Samiam will be releasing a double LP/ CD collection entitled “Orphan Works” on No Idea Records on September 7th. The 18 track collection consists of studio outtakes, in-studio radio shows and live recordings from the “Clumsy” and “You Are Freaking Me Out” period of the band’s career.

To celebrate the release, the band will be touring Europe starting October 19th with Death in the Family and Former Cell Mates. Expect confirmed dates to be announced in the weeks to come.

They will be breaking in their new drummer, Charlie Walker of Chamberlain/Split Lip on this tour.

Samiam formed in late 1988 after the break of up of Gilman’s Isocracy. Samiam released seven albums in their career on several labels including “Hopeless”, “Burning Heart”, “Atlantic”, “New Red Archive”, and “Igition/Tommy Boy”.

No Idea Records has announced the details for the new studio album from Defiance, Ohio. The album is titled “Midwestern Minutes” and was recorded this past March and April by Mike Bridavsky at Russian Recording Studio in the band’s hometown of Bloomington, Indiana. Bridavsky also produced the band’s critically acclaimed previous album “The Fear, The Fear, The Fear,” released by No Idea Records in late 2007.

The 11-song album will be released on LP/CD via No Idea Records on July 6th 2010.

You can check out an early leak of the track “Hairpool” on the band’s No Idea Records profile page.

The band is currently booking an extensive US tour starting in June. Dates will be announced shortly.

Bassist/vocalist Ryan Woods offered a brief communiqué from the studio:

“I’m not sure what it will turn out like, but I do feel it is a bit of a change. I think we were a lot more careful in arranging the songs, for example, a lot more thought-out harmonies, some songs have lots of strings, some none at all. There is a lot more use of the piano, a Wurlitzer, and a return of the upright bass on some songs. A couple of the songs are quite theatrical in content and orchestrated musically. In contrast, I think a couple songs are also more “punk” sounding than the last record. We are very excited! I feel like we really worked as a group to make the songs and I think it will be a really good representation of where we are as a band now, for better or for worse.”
